Recently, a Weibo user posted this image of Chinese senior ladies square-dancing in Place du Louvre in France. The group dancing, or guangchangwu, is a favorite past time for middle-aged and retired women in China who find it a good way to keep fit and socialize. It’s also often seen as a nuisance to local residents who are exposed to the amplified music blaring along with the choreographed dancing on a nightly occurrence.
